Rural/Tribal Course Fee Waiver Request

Thank you for your interest in an Infopeople online course! Califa Group is offering a limited number of course fee waivers in Infopeople courses to staff at rural public libraries and tribal libraries in the USA & Canada.
There are up to three no-cost seats available in each course on a first-come, first-served basis once a course has been published on Infopeople's course listing page.
Please note: in order to provide this no-cost opportunity to a wide audience, there is a limit of one course fee waiver per person during each annual training cycle.
Please complete this form and an Infopeople team member will follow-up with you via email within 3-4 business days regarding the status of your request.
